private static String findByMethodName(Class<?> type, String methodName) {
return Arrays.stream(type.getDeclaredMethods())
.map(Method::getName)
.filter(declaredMethodName -> declaredMethodName.startsWith(methodName))
.findFirst()
.orElseThrow(() -> newIllegalArgumentException("No method with name [%1$s] was found on class [%2$s]",
methodName, type.getName()));
}
private static Optional<String> safeFindByMethodName(Class<?> type, String methodName) {
try {
return Optional.of(findByMethodName(type, methodName));
}
catch (Throwable ignore) {
return Optional.empty();
}
}
private static boolean isOverriddenMethodPresent(Object target, String methodName) {
return Optional.ofNullable(target)
.map(Object::getClass)
.flatMap(targetType -> safeFindByMethodName(targetType, methodName))
.isPresent();
}

private void applySpringSessionGemFireConfigurer() {
resolveSpringSessionGemFireConfigurer()
.map(this::applyClientRegionShortcut)
.map(this::applyIndexableSessionAttributes)
.map(this::applyMaxInactiveIntervalInSeconds)
.map(this::applyPoolName)
.map(this::applyServerRegionShortcut)
.map(this::applySessionRegionName)
.map(this::applySessionSerializerBeanName);
}
private <T> SpringSessionGemFireConfigurer applySpringSessionGemFireConfigurerConfiguration(
SpringSessionGemFireConfigurer configurer, String methodName,
Function<SpringSessionGemFireConfigurer, T> getter, Consumer<T> setter) {
Optional.ofNullable(configurer)
.filter(it -> isOverriddenMethodPresent(configurer, methodName))
.map(getter)
.ifPresent(setter);
return configurer;
}
